The Seibu Lions said Tuesday it will change the name of its home stadium from Goodwill Dome to Seibu Dome after the contract for the naming rights between the club and Goodwill Group Inc. was formally canceled.

Seibu's farm team, which had assumed the name Goodwill after the deal in December 2006, will be called the Saitama Seibu Lions.

Both changes will go into effect Wednesday. Seibu club president Shinji Kobayashi said, although there have been several suitors, there are no immediate plans for another company to purchase the club's naming rights.

"There have been several companies who wish to purchase the naming rights, but we have decided to be cautious. This is a new start and we want to go back to our original way," Kobayashi said.
